Unlike traditional builders who require 10–50% down, we require $0 upfront. Your contract is binding, but your money stays in your account until work is complete.
Subcontractors are paid only after we confirm their work is complete, while material suppliers are paid upfront before materials are released for delivery.

Before each payment milestone, our team inspects workmanship against contract specs. You receive photo documentation and a checklist confirming readiness for payment. If an inspection is required, we verify that the inspection has passed before a payment is due.
Payments to both, The Backyard Company and approved vendors, can be paid by credit card, ACH, or check, giving homeowners control over how funds are released. Please note that certain payment methods may include processing fees, which will be clearly outlined prior to each transaction.
For every payment to an approved vendor, The Backyard Company will secure a release of lien in exchange for the payment being made.
The Backyard Company uses a simple, transparent two-part management fee structure designed to align with homeowner control and project progress. Construction Management (CM) fees are collected only when a vendor payment is made, ensuring you pay management costs in direct proportion to verified work completed. Project Management (PM) fees begin once the project enters the excavation phase and are billed weekly to cover hands-on coordination, scheduling, and on-site oversight throughout the build.
Minor punch-out items will not delay vendor payments, as payments are issued upon verified completion of the contracted scope of work. All vendor warranties become active only after final payment for that vendor’s portion of the project has been made in full. This ensures clear completion, accountability, and warranty validation for every trade involved.
This policy eliminates the #1 risk in pool building: losing deposits to bankrupt or dishonest builders. Your money stays protected until you approve quality.
